Troubleshooting Common Login Issues
We've all been there – you're pumped for a game, you go to log in, and...bam! Something goes wrong. Don't stress! Here are some common issues and how to fix them:
- Forgot Password: This is probably the most common problem. If you've forgotten your password, click the "Forgot Password" link on the login page. You'll be prompted to enter your email address, and a password reset link will be sent to your inbox. Follow the instructions in the email to create a new password. Make sure to choose a strong password that you'll remember, but also one that's difficult for others to guess. Consider using a password manager to keep track of your passwords securely.
- Incorrect Email Address: Double-check that you're using the correct email address associated with your account. It's easy to accidentally use an old email or make a typo. If you're not sure which email address is linked to your account, contact the Gator football tickets office for assistance.
- Account Locked: If you've entered the wrong password too many times, your account might be temporarily locked for security reasons. Wait a few minutes and try again. If you're still locked out, contact the ticket office to have your account unlocked.
- Website Issues: Sometimes, the ticketing website might experience technical difficulties. If you're unable to log in, check the UAA's social media channels or website for announcements about any known issues. Try clearing your browser's cache and cookies, or try using a different browser. If the problem persists, try again later.
- Browser Compatibility: Ensure that you are using a compatible web browser. Outdated browsers can sometimes cause login issues. Try updating your browser to the latest version or use a different browser altogether.
